These Are The Top Rated Winter Tires For The Toyota RAV4

We researched the best winter tires for the Toyota RAV4 and found these models at the top.

Winter is coming. Although the Toyota RAV4 is a great snow vehicle when equipped with AWD, the extra drive wheels don't help you turn or stop. Winter tires do. We looked at Tire Rack's customer reviews to find the two best models of winter tires for the top-selling RAV4. Here is what we found:

Best Overall Winter Tire For RAV4
The Blizzak DM-V2 is rated a 9.5 in winter driving. One RAV4 owner was prompted to say in a review, "The traction and braking on unplowed (we have a looooong hilly driveway which we do not plow in Connecticut) and untreated roads is really outstanding. It is night and day from out OEM all season tires. I am very impressed with this product."

Torque News has tested this very tire on both a Subaru Forester and Toyota Highlander and we were very impressed by its overall performance as well as snow and ice. At about $124 the tires are basically free, since they give your 3-season tires a rest while they work.

Best Long-Lasting Winter Tire For RAV4
Those looking for a little more life in a winter tire may look to the Michelin Latitude X-Ice X12. One RAV4 owner ran them past the 30K miles mark and then wrote this: "I ran them through last summer and come fall the still had legal tread, so I tried them in our first snow storm. They STILL had decent traction, even on ice, so I ran them through the winter. The rears are now starting to wear through the last of the siping, so I will put my Conti all seasons on soon. We had our last storm in late February, so I tested them in the snow. Not bad for tires that are almost worn out."
